All of our technicians have many years of experience repairing cracked baths and they know how to spot when the damage is easily repairable, or if it does unfortunately need to be replaced. In most cases, the crack is superficial and can be repaired to a high standard. When the crack is structural, affecting the bath's integrity or caused by poor installation, it’s best not to repair it as the crack may reoccur. Our technicians are adept at identifying the type of crack and deciding the best course of action for your bath. 1. The technician will evaluate the crack to determine whether it can be easily repaired or if it’s structural. If it’s found to be structural damage, we won’t recommend repairing it and will not offer a warranty on any repair.
2. The technician will then clean the area and reinforce the crack from the underside of the bath to make sure it's watertight. 3. The crack will be filled in and smoothed out so that it’s no longer noticeable. 4. Next, the technician will apply a specialised bonder to the repair, preparing it for the next stage. 5. A custom enamel paint will be colour matched to your bath’s exact white shade, ensuring the repair blends seamlessly. This will be applied using a fine spray gun. 6. Leave your bath for 24 hours before using it so the repair can fully cure and set. 7. Relax and use your bath like normal, no need for costly replacement!
Depending on the extent of the crack and if it is structural - your repair will take anywhere from 1-2 hours to half a day. Much faster than removing and replacing your bath!

When customers ask why they should choose our services over a DIY repair kit, we suggest they try it out but contact us when it fails to deliver. The problem with the DIY repair kits is the quality of the materials they provide are totally substandard to the professional grade materials we use, and they won't last as long. It's also very hard to achieve a true colour match to the surface of your bath as the repair kit will only provide you with one or two shades of white to use on your repair.
